Default Question on replacing instrument cluster

I have a fault with my current instrument cluster on my 2001 XKR. It puts up bogus alerts including "restricted engine performance" and "check rear lights". The engine is not in restricted performance though and the rear lights are fine. The car runs fine other than the warnings and lights on the panel. The panel itself is reporting a U1261 code on the scanner.

I have a spare used panel but I am not sure if I can just swap it out.

The label in the trunk with all the computer module numbers on it indicates my panel (IPK) is LJE 4300DB/107

The number on the spare panel is LJD4300KB/104

Can I just swap these? Also do I need to reprogram the car at all once I put the other panel in?

The 4.0 X100 (as well as the X308) does not have a VID block so it will not need configuration to the car.
The mileage will be permanent in the INSTPK from the original vehicle.
The mileage part of the ISTPK might be able to be removed and soldered in the replacement so it reads actual mileage to the car.

If BOTH are SUPERCHARGED and BOTH are similar mileage, then it should be 'plug&play'.
